首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将值发送到React-Native中的函数

可以通过使用props或者回调函数来实现。

在React-Native中,可以通过props将值从父组件传递到子组件。父组件可以将值作为props属性传递给子组件,并通过props在子组件中访问该值。这样可以实现将值发送到React-Native组件中的函数。

另一种常见的方式是使用回调函数。父组件可以定义一个函数,并将该函数作为props属性传递给子组件。子组件可以通过调用该函数并将值作为参数传递给父组件,从而将值发送到React-Native中的函数。

以下是一个示例:

父组件:

代码语言:txt
复制
import React from 'react';
import ChildComponent from './ChildComponent';

class ParentComponent extends React.Component {
  constructor(props) {
    super(props);
    this.state = {
      value: 'Hello React-Native!',
    };
    this.handleValueChange = this.handleValueChange.bind(this);
  }

  handleValueChange(newValue) {
    this.setState({ value: newValue });
  }

  render() {
    return (
      <ChildComponent value={this.state.value} onValueChange={this.handleValueChange} />
    );
  }
}

export default ParentComponent;

子组件:

代码语言:txt
复制
import React from 'react';
import { Text, Button } from 'react-native';

class ChildComponent extends React.Component {
  constructor(props) {
    super(props);
    this.handleChangeClick = this.handleChangeClick.bind(this);
  }

  handleChangeClick() {
    const newValue = 'New value from child';
    this.props.onValueChange(newValue);
  }

  render() {
    return (
      <>
        <Text>{this.props.value}</Text>
        <Button title="Change Value" onPress={this.handleChangeClick} />
      </>
    );
  }
}

export default ChildComponent;

在上面的示例中,父组件通过props将value属性和handleValueChange函数传递给子组件。子组件通过调用handleValueChange函数并传递一个新的值,实现将值发送到React-Native中的函数。

注意:这只是一个示例,实际上在开发中可能会有更复杂的逻辑和数据处理。具体的实现方式可能因项目的需求而有所不同。

推荐的腾讯云相关产品:腾讯云移动应用云开发(https://cloud.tencent.com/product/tcb)是一个集成了云函数、云数据库、云存储和云托管等能力的移动后端云服务。它提供了一套完整的移动应用开发框架和工具,可帮助开发者快速构建和部署移动应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

箭头函数this

其实那只是其中一个因素,还有一个因素就是在ZnHobbies方法this已经不属于上一个区块,而这里this并没有name。...所以 解决办法其中一个就是在ZnHobbies函数写入 var that = this; 然后this替换成that,所以输出结果,就有了lucifer名字啦。...还有的一个办法就是ZnHobbies函数map改写成箭头函数: ZnHobbies: function () { this.hobbies.map((hobby)=...为什么箭头函数可以达到这样效果呢?是因为箭头函数没有它自己'this'。它this是继承于它父作用域。...所以它不会随着调用方法改变而改变,所以这里this就指向它父级作用域,而上一个this指向是Lucifer这个Object。所以我们就能准确得到Lucifername啦。

2.2K20

CSV数据发送到kafka(java版)

欢迎访问我GitHub 这里分类和汇总了欣宸全部原创(含配套源码):https://github.com/zq2599/blog_demos 为什么CSV数据发到kafka flink做流式计算时...,选用kafka消息作为数据源是常用手段,因此在学习和开发flink过程,也会将数据集文件记录发送到kafka,来模拟不间断数据; 整个流程如下: [在这里插入图片描述] 您可能会觉得这样做多此一举...这样做原因如下: 首先,这是学习和开发时做法,数据集是CSV文件,而生产环境实时数据却是kafka数据源; 其次,Java应用可以加入一些特殊逻辑,例如数据处理,汇总统计(用来和flink结果对比验证...); 另外,如果两条记录实际间隔时间如果是1分钟,那么Java应用在发送消息时也可以间隔一分钟再发送,这个逻辑在flink社区demo中有具体实现,此demo也是数据集发送到kafka,再由flink...消费kafka,地址是:https://github.com/ververica/sql-training 如何CSV数据发送到kafka 前面的图可以看出,读取CSV再发送消息到kafka操作是

3.4K30
  • 如何Flink应用日志发送到kafka

    全家桶是比较成熟开源日志检索方案,flink日志搜集要做就是日志打到kafka,剩余工作交由ELK完成即可。...flink应用集成logback进行日志打点,通过logback-kafka-appender日志发送到kafka logstash消费kafka日志消息送入es,通过kibana进行检索 核心问题...如何在topic中区分出指定应用日志 需要在flink日志拼上业务应用名称app name列进行应用区分 通过logback自定义layout方式打上flink业务应用名称 独立flink...kafka测试 编写一个简单flink-demo应用,在窗口apply方法打一波日志 ?...可以发现自定义Flink业务应用名称已经打到了日志上,kafka日志显示正常,flink应用日志发送到kafka测试完成。

    2.3K20

    python函数返回详解

    1.返回介绍 现实生活场景: 我给儿子10块钱,让他给我买包烟。...这个例子,10块钱是我给儿子,就相当于调用函数时传递到参数,让儿子买烟这个事情最终目标是,让他把烟给你带回来然后给你对么,,,此时烟就是返回 开发场景: 定义了一个函数,完成了获取室内温度,...想一想是不是应该把这个结果给调用者,只有调用者拥有了这个返回,才能够根据当前温度做适当调整 综上所述: 所谓“返回”,就是程序函数完成一件事情后,最后给调用者结果 2.带有返回函数 想要在函数把结果返回给调用者....保存函数返回 在本小节刚开始时候,说过“买烟”例子,最后儿子给你烟时,你一定是从儿子手中接过来 对么,程序也是如此,如果一个函数返回了一个数据,那么想要用这个数据,那么就需要保存 保存函数返回示例如下...5.在python我们可不可以返回多个

    3.3K20

    MySQLifnull()函数判断空

    我们知道,在不同数据库引擎,内置函数实现、命名都是存在差异,如果经常切换使用这几个数据库引擎的话,很容易会将这些函数弄混淆。...比如说判断空函数,在Oracle是NVL()函数、NVL2()函数,在SQL Server是ISNULL()函数,这些函数都包含了当值为空时候返回替换成另一个第二参数。...但是在MySQL,ISNULL()函数仅仅是用于判断空,接受一个参数并返回一个布尔,不提供当值为空时候返回替换成另一个第二参数。...简单介绍 IFNULL()函数是MySQL内置控制流函数之一,它接受两个参数,第一个参数是要判断空字段或(傻?),第二个字段是当第一个参数是空情况下要替换返回另一个。...如果第一个参数不是NULL,则返回第一个参数;否则,返回第二个参数。两个参数都可以是文字或表达式。

    9.8K10

    Session储存于SQL Server

    Asp.Net提供了下面一些方法储存Session: InProc State Server SQL Server “InProc”表示我们使用传统ASP一样方法储存Session,而且“State...Server”则表示使用另外一台主机来储存Session。...在我机器,它存在于E:WINNTMicrosoft.NETFrameworkv1.0.2914目录。这个文件是微软自己提供,里面有很全SQL语句,大家放心使用。下图就是生成数据表。...修改你web.config文件,指定Sessionmode为SQL Server web.configsessionState部分改成: <sessionState mode="SQLServer...这个程序只是简单<em>的</em>储存一个字符串数据于Session<em>中</em>,然后再显示这个数据在Label控件<em>中</em>。 现在所有的Session变量都储存在数据表<em>中</em>,而不是内存中了。

    83920

    matlab插函数作用,matlab 插函数

    大家好,又见面了,我是你们朋友全栈君。...MATLAB函数为interp1,其调用格式为: yi= interp1(x,y,xi,’method’) 其中x,y为插点,yi为在被插点xi处结果;x,y为向量, ‘method...’表示采用方法,MATLAB提供方法有几种: ‘method’是最邻近插, ‘linear’线性插; ‘spline’三次样条插; ‘cubic’立方插.缺省时表示线性插 注意:所有的插方法都要求...x是单调,并且xi不能够超过x范围。...例如:在一 天24小时内,从零点开始每间隔2小时测得环境温度数据分别为 12,9,9,1,0,18 ,24,28,27,25,20,18,15,13, 推测中午12点(即13点)时温度. x=0:2

    1.3K10

    React-Native 开发小技巧

    ) || 'default'; 上面例子,firstName属性在对象第四层,所以需要判断四次,每一层是否有。...true; 上面代码,默认只有在左侧属性为null或undefined时,才会生效。 这个运算符一个目的,就是跟链判断运算符?.配合使用,为null或undefined设置默认。...300; 上面代码,response.settings如果是null或undefined,就会返回默认300。...箭头函数 this(见:ES6语法函数扩展) 在JavaScript this对象指向是可变,但是在箭头函数,它是固定化,也可以称为静态。...this指向固定化,并不是因为箭头函数内部有绑定this机制,实际原因是箭头函数根本没有自己this,导致内部this就是外层代码块this。

    2.2K10

    Linuxsystem函数返回详解

    描述 system()库函数使用fork(2)创建一个子进程,该子进程使用execl(3)执行指定shell命令, execl("/bin/sh", “sh”, “-c”, command,...如果子进程无法创建,或者其状态不能被检索,则返回为-1; 如果在子进程不能执行一个shell,或shell未正常结束,返回被写入到status低8~15比特位;一般为127 如果所有系统调用都成功..., shell返回填到status低8~15比特位 系统宏 系统中提供了两个宏WIFEXITED(status)、WEXITSTATUS(status)判断shell返回 WIFEXITED...(status) 用来指出子进程是否为正常退出,如果是,它会返回一个非零 WEXITSTATUS(status) 用来获取返回status低8~15数据 有了这两个宏代码就简介很多,...命令是否正确执行 Linux system函数返回 父进程等待子进程终止 wait, WIFEXITED, WEXITSTATUS

    11.3K30

    java如何取绝对(调用绝对函数)

    大家好,又见面了,我是你们朋友全栈君。 一、绝对函数使用说明 绝对函数是JDKMath.java实现方法,其用来得到表达式绝对。...-a : a; } 二、绝对特性及其运用。 1、正数绝对是其本身。 2、负数绝对是其相反数。 3、零绝对是其本身。 绝对:自减函数配合绝对,先降序再升序。...4、每行左右对称,每行输出字母数 = 行数*2 +1(字母A); 3、实现 1、实现分析1~3步。以‘A’为中心点,先降序,再升序输出每行图案。...A’ + Math.abs(row-i); System.out.print(((char)printChar)+” “); } } 输出如下: F E D C B A B C D E F 2、步骤4,...,希望本文内容对大家学习或者工作能带来一定帮助,如果有疑问大家可以留言交流。

    5K40

    函数基础,函数返回,函数调用3方式,形参与实参

    5.29自我总结 一.函数基础 1.什么是函数 在程序,函数是具有种功能功能工具 2.函数两个阶段 1.函数定义 a)有参函数定义 在函数定义阶段括号内有参数,称为有参函数。...需要注意是:定义时有参,意味着调用时也必须传入参数。 如果函数体代码逻辑需要依赖外部传入,必须得定义成有参函数。...def 函数名(param1、param2……x=9): #其中paraml1与param2为函数需要填入,x为默认参数 '''对于函数描述''' 函数功能描述信息 :...def func(): pass 2.函数简单调用 a)有参函数调用 def函数名(param1、param2……)) #默认参数可以不用填写,如果填写覆盖原来参数值 b)无参函数调用 func...() c)空函数调用 func() 二.函数返回函数返回给: 如 def Than_the_size(num_1,num_2): if num_1>num_2: print

    2K20

    JS函数本质,定义、调用,以及函数参数和返回

    : 作为数据保存在一个变量 var fn=function(){ return "这是一个函数"; } console.log(fn());//这是一个函数 console.log(fn); /*...,外层不能访问里层函数 代码块定义函数: 由于js没有块级作用域,所以依然是处于全局作用域中 都会出现预解析函数被提前声明 if(true){ function fn1(){ } }...: 构造函数命名时一般首字母大写 调用时用new+函数名,返回是一个对象 function Person(){ } var obj=new Person(); js内置构造函数,常见有: Object...call和apply方法,两者唯一区别在于它们传参方式 ---- 函数参数 参数传递本质是实参赋值给形参 参数个数 1、形参个数=实参个数 function add(n1,n2){ return...回调函数,如 setTimeout(fn, time); ---- 函数返回 return: 表示函数结束 返回 什么可以做返回: 直接return ,返回是undefined 数字 字符串

    17.6K20

    函数(二)(函数调用与传递)

    被调函数执行到return语句或执行完最后一条语句时,程序执行流程重新回到主调函数离开位置,继续执行主调函数后面的语句或表达式。...调用定义了形参函数时需要把实参传递给形参,前面说过,实参必须与函数定义形参在次序和数量上匹配,在数据类型上兼容。...C语言同时规定,实参向形参传递数据是单向传递。 例:使用函数实现交换两个整数。...,main函数实参变量x和y并没有发生交换,为什么会出现这样情况呢?...按照C语言参数传递规则,实参变量x和y分别被“单向传递”给形参变量a和b,swap函数对变量a和b进行了交换,而变量a和b变化不会影响实参变量x和y,因此造成上述程序运行结果。

    83350
    领券